Area Golf: Camp Confidence needs big hitters

Camp Classic

What: Golf and fishing fundraiser for Confidence Learning Center

Where: Madden's Resort

When: June 17-18

New: A Long Drive competition June 16

Few things can be said to be inaugural when dealing with the storied history of the Confidence Learning Center Golf Classic.

In its 43rd season of raising money for Camp Confidence, the tournament has used different venues, but found a home at The Classic at Madden's Resort the last seven years. Five years ago the tournament committee added a nine-hole option for those too busy for 18 holes.

This season, however, something new to the fundraising tournament and the area is happening.

The inaugural Camp Classic Long Drive competition, sponsored by Brenny Funeral Chapel, is scheduled for 5:30 p.m. June 16 at Madden's Airport Driving Range.

The night before the 18-hole, four-person scramble, 32 men and 16 women will compete in a bracketed long drive competition. Prize money totaling $3,000 will be awarded to the top three in each division as well as random draw positions.

"We have had 43 years of Classic tradition in our golf outing and tradition is awesome, but sometimes you need to change things up or add to it," said Sarah Smith, events coordinator at Confidence Learning Center. "So this is kind of an idea, when looking at what other big golf tournaments have done, we thought we should have a long drive competition because this area really doesn't have one."

The event is open to amateurs only. Matchups on the bracket will be selected using a random draw. The cost to enter is $100 per participant with USGA rules governing the event. Food and beverages will be available during the event, which Smith said is almost half full already.

The two winners will each receive $500. Second-place finishers will earn $250 and $100 will go to third place. There will be two random draws per division. There will also be other awards for best dressed and other miscellaneous categories.

"Fifteenth place might get something. 32nd place might get something," Smith said. "We're giving cash prizes to fun things like best dressed as well. Our goal is to really keep this fun.

"We're hoping on our part that this just becomes another great aspect of a fundraiser for camp. We want to do this in a fun way. We're hoping that this is also a new way to bring in more people who may or may not know about Camp or the Camp Classic. That's why we're doing this on Thursday evening. It's a new part to kickoff the events, especially for those who maybe aren't able to take Friday off to golf in the golf classic."

The golf classic will once again be at The Classic with registration at noon and a 1:15 p.m. shotgun start. The nine-hole tournament will be at Madden's Pine Beach West with registration starting at 2:15 p.m. and a shotgun start at 3:30 p.m.

The 33rd annual Nick Adams Memorial Fishing Classic is scheduled for 8 a.m. June 18.
